§ 6-19-127 — Parental monitors on school buses

Text

(a)The purpose of this section is to protect children from abusive behavior while riding a school bus.
(b)A school district board of directors may create and implement a program to authorize a parent of a child enrolled in the school district to act as a monitor in a school bus.
(c)The Commission for Arkansas Public School Academic Facilities and Transportation shall adopt rules to implement this section.
(d)A parental monitor under this section is a qualified volunteer under the Arkansas Volunteer Immunity Act, § 16-6-101 et seq.

Legislative History

Acts 2011, No. 984, § 1.
